    The **SD25-331-R** is a specific model of power inductor manufactured by **Eaton (formerly Bussmann)**. It belongs to the **SD25 series**, which is characterized by its shielded drum core construction and low profile. --- ### 1. General Specifications The part number "SD25-331-R" can be broken down to understand its primary characteristics: | Parameter | Value | Description | | :--- | :--- | :--- | | **Series** | SD25 | Shielded Drum, 5.2mm x 5.2mm footprint | | **Inductance** | 330 µH | The nominal inductance (331 = 33 + one zero) | | **Tolerance** | ±20% | Standard industry tolerance for power inductors | | **RoHS** | -R | Suffix indicating lead-free/RoHS compliance | --- ### 2. Technical Performance This component is designed for high-density power applications. Below are the typical electrical ratings for this specific part: * **Inductance:** 330 Microhenries (µH) * **DC Resistance (DCR):** Approximately 2.45 Ohms (Ω) — This is the internal resistance of the copper wire. * **Rated Current (Irms):** ~0.33 Amperes — The current at which the temperature rises by 40°C. * **Saturation Current (Isat):** ~0.35 Amperes — The current at which the inductance drops by 30%. * **Operating Temperature:** -40°C to +125°C. --- ### 3. Key Physical Features The SD25 series is favored in modern electronics for several reasons: * **Magnetic Shielding:** The ferrite drum core is wrapped in a magnetic shield. This minimizes **Electromagnetic Interference (EMI)**, ensuring it doesn't interfere with nearby sensitive components. * **Low Profile:** With a height of roughly 2.5mm, it is ideal for thin consumer electronics. * **Surface Mount (SMD):** Designed for automated PCB assembly processes. --- ### 4. Common Applications Due to its high inductance (330µH) and moderate current handling, the SD25-331-R is typically used in: 1. **DC-DC Converters:** Buck, Boost, and SEPIC topologies. 2. **LED Drivers:** Providing steady current for lighting circuits. 3. **Battery Powered Devices:** Mobile phones, digital cameras, and handheld sensors. 4. **Filtering:** Used as a low-pass filter to remove noise from power supply lines. ---
